Transmission Service Case Study: What We Found Inside This Transmission Oil Pan

At Gejay Automotive in Bendigo, we recently inspected a vehicle that had been experiencing transmission problems, including slipping between gears and noticeable clunking during gear changes. These symptoms are often early warning signs that something isn't quite right inside the transmission and should never be ignored.

To investigate further, our technicians removed the transmission oil pan and immediately found a significant amount of metal shavings and debris collected in the bottom of the pan. Metal contamination like this is a clear indication of internal component wear and can suggest that the transmission has been operating with degraded fluid or has missed scheduled maintenance intervals.

Transmission fluid plays a critical role in lubricating internal components, controlling hydraulic pressure, and helping to keep operating temperatures under control. Over time, transmission fluid breaks down and loses its ability to properly protect the transmission. When servicing is delayed, excessive wear can occur, leading to costly repairs or even complete transmission failure.

In this case, the metal contamination highlighted the importance of routine transmission servicing. Regular transmission fluid and filter changes can help remove contaminants, improve shifting performance, reduce wear, and potentially extend the life of your transmission.
